iPhone not as popular as expected
Apple’s iPhone hasn’t quite been the sales success many thought and after a strong run up to Christmas post the festivities it’s declined.
I don’t think the problem is not the device itself, I’ve played with one and was impressed by the form factor and the UI, although I don’t know if some aspects to all that gesturing might begin to be plain annoying after a while. But the real issues are the lack of an out of the box connector for work based email and….the price. All up with the 18 month contract we’re talking a penny short of £900, the handset itself being the fat end of £300, which for a country raised on discounted or free handsets is about as popular as Jade Goody. Prices have already fallen in the US and the 4Gb model has dropped so maybe the UK market reciprocate.
